An electronic locking device including a cylinder and a plug located in the cylinder. Within the plug is a solenoid with a pair of shuttles which move in opposite directions. A control processor controls the solenoids activating the shuttles when connected to the correct key. Blocking elements for each shuttle are inserted through the cylinder and into annular channels in the plug. The blocking elements receive and allow linear movement of the shuttles but prevent their rotation within the annular channels. In a locked condition the shuttles are contained only partially within the annular channels thereby preventing rotation of the plug within the cylinder but in an unlocked condition the shuttles are contained within the annular channels thereby allowing rotation of the plug. The plug also includes a weakness defining a point at which it will break upon application of excessive force.
